
Willamette Valley Vacations
Book a Hotel + Flight or Car together to unlock savings
- Plan, book, travel with confidence
- Better togetherSave up to ₩234,741 when you book a flight and hotel together*
- Find the right fitWith over 300,000 hotels worldwide, it's easy to create a perfect package
- Rest easyPlan, book, and manage your trip all in one place
Where to stay in Willamette Valley

Downtown Portland
Explore the Portland Art Museum, Oregon Historical Society, and Tom McCall Waterfront Park in this central business district with high-rise buildings. Enjoy walkable streets, and easily access public transportation like MAX light rail and Portland Streetcar.
Find the Best Willamette Valley Vacation Packages
Willamette Valley Hotel Deals

Hayward Inn
Everything was new and clean. The staff was super friendly and helpful. The free breakfast was delicious and had lots of selections. Our only minor complaint is that the way the door of the bathroom and the toilet were situated, it was a bit of a tight fit to close the door.
Reviewed on Jan 5, 2026

The Paramount Hotel
The staff was very welcoming and friendly. The room was spacious and comfortable. The only complaint was the water didn’t stay hot enough. But other than that we enjoyed ourselves.
Reviewed on Jan 5, 2026

Holiday Inn Airport - Portland by IHG
Restaurant is closed indefinitely. I can’t comment on breakfast because it wasn’t available before I left to the airport. The Staff was fantastic
Reviewed on Jan 5, 2026
Discover the most popular places to visit in Willamette Valley

University of Oregon
Explore the campus of University of Oregon, during your travels in Eugene. Attend a sporting event or simply visit the area's shops.

Wildlife Safari
Why not see the exotic and native animals who live at Wildlife Safari during your vacation in Winston? While you're in the area, stroll along the riverfront.
Oregon State University
Take a campus tour or just explore the area of Oregon State University, during your trip to Corvallis. You can attend a sporting event while in the area.




